IL-33 belongs to the IL-1 family and is closely related in structure to IL-18 and IL-1b. IL-33 is synthesized as a biologically inactive precursor and is cleaved by the enzyme caspase-1 and secreted as a mature active form. IL-33 stimulates target cells by binding to the IL-1R/TLR superfamily member ST2 and subsequently activates NF-κB and MAPK pathways via identical signaling events to those observed for IL-1b. IL-33 is an inducer of Th2 cytokines such as IL-5 and IL-13. It is also a nuclear factor (NF-HEV) abundantly expressed in high endothelial venules from lymphoid organs that associates with chromatin and exhibits transcriptional regulatory properties.
BioLegend’s LEGEND MAX™ Human IL-33 ELISA kit is a Sandwich Enzyme-Linked Immunosorbent Assay (ELISA) with a 96-well strip plate that is pre-coated with a capture antibody. This kit is specifically designed for the accurate quantitation of human IL-33 from cell culture supernatant, serum, plasma and other biological fluids. It is analytically validated with ready-to-use reagents.
